Who am I?
My name is Andy Cavell, I’m a husband & dad. I’m a proud Yorkshire bloke who loves photography.
Having grown up in Leeds in the 1980’s in an area named Seacroft; where times were tough & there was little room for creative expression, photography wasn’t exactly commonplace.
At 16 years old I got my 1st digital camera (a Kodak with a printing dock) - I was hooked, I loved being able to see a scene and freeze that point in time with this camera. The magic then became real when I made prints from the photographs - seeing the 6x4 sheet move back and forth through that little printer laying down yellows, then magenta, and blue then finally delivering the finished photograph. Mind blown!
As I moved into young adulthood I continued with my love of cameras and photography, investing in equipment and constantly striving to improve technically as well as creatively.
As a fully fledged middle aged man these days, I continue to love the joy of getting out with the camera and hoping to create something that makes me smile. Having spent years trying to second guess what makes everyone else happy, I have realised (probably later than I should’ve) that if I am enjoying creating things, then everything else is a bonus.
